Winning always takes teamwork, but on Saturday Kenna Batty stepped things up a notch to give Parke Heritage the 'W'. Batty did her part (and then some), going 2-for-3 with four RBI, a triple, and a run for the 'W'.
Batty and Parke Heritage will play host again on Wednesday to welcome South Vermillion, where first pitch is scheduled at 5:00 p.m. The last time Batty duked it out with South Vermillion (last Tuesday), Parke Heritage came out on top by a score of 5-4.
